Fingerplays and Rhymes
Favorite Storytime Fingerplays & Rhymes
Bubble Bubble Pop! (narrative skills)
Creatures of the Sea (shapes, narrative skills, dexterity)
Dance Your Fingers (dexterity, body awareness)
Five Elephants in the Bathtub (early numeracy)
Five Street Sweepers with Newberg Public Works (early numeracy)
Grandmother's Glasses (narrative skills)
Green Means Go (colors, self-regulation)
Heckety Peckety (vocabulary, phonemic awareness)
I Can Make a Heart & Have Some Tea with Me (body awareness, shapes-letter recognition)
Little Mousie Brown Went to Town (vocabulary, guessing game)
My Thumbs Are Starting to Wiggle & Form the Orange (rhyming)
A Nest is a Home for a Robin (narrative skills)
Open Them Shut Them (dexterity)
Slowly, Slowly (concepts- slow/fast)
Teeny Tiny Mouse (dexterity, slow/fast)
Ten Fingers (early numeracy) 1 minute
Ten Wild Horses (early numeracy skills)
This is Big (concept awareness)
Walking, Walking (body awareness, self regulation)
Well, Hello Everybody (body awareness)
Whoops Johnny! (dexterity)
Zoom, Zoom, Zoom (rhyming, early numeracy skills)
